I can answer that. Max range will be 300 yards. But..... You will be shooting off-hand, kneeling, sitting and prone. We will also be shooting the 4 inch MGM targets at 100 yards. possibly off-hand or another non-prone position.. The tests for the match will be for any setup, regardless of sighting choice. Shoot what you are most comfortable with and don't get hung up on divisions.. I personally prefer irons for many reasons, but mainly because of astigmatisms, I do not shoot scopes/RDS very well.
